About Lydia Lathrop

DAR MATRON OF THE AMERICAN REVOLUTION - Lydia Tracy Leffingwell born on 28 - Jul - 1706 at Norwitch CT died at Norwitch CT on 2 - Apr - 1766 married Ebenezer Lathrop on 13 - Aug - 1725 -tcd
